Maze of the Week #93 is of a cool building in the great city of London, England, London City Hall, which is located on the south bank of the River Thames near Tower Bridge. Well that is not entirely true, because this was London City Hall between 2002 and 2021, but the city hall has since moved ! Maze of the Week #92 takes us to the Massachusetts Institute of Technology in Cambridge, MA which a normal person just calls MIT. This is their Kresge Auditorium building which is used for the performing arts. Designed by famous architect Eero Saarinen the building was completed and opened in 1955. Maze of the Week #84 is of the Riverside Museum in Glasgow, Scotland, our first maze from Scotland. Would you believe that this museum is located on a riverside ? It is, the River Clyde. It is a transport museum designed by Zaha Hadid Architects. It is also not the first maze I have made from these architects:

The building opened in 2011 and in 2013 it won the prestigious European Museum of the Year Award. You can learn more about the museum here.
